well it concerns me a lot so I am putting it at the top of my list,
there are possible security implications.

I have found that your article, as far as I can tell, has simply
disappeared from our database BUT that the command to remove it is not
in our logs. I can't figure out why. 

I did notice that we had the default password set for story
administration so that anyone who was an "insider" in the IMC universe
could come in and mess with our stories if they wanted but I checked
the logs and no one has ever accessed the story administration scripts
(I hadn't accessed them because I didn't know they existed until now).

I have changed the password to a secure random string since we don't
currently use that feature. In the future I will change it to
something we can share but keep secret.

I am stumped.

I checked and story id's 120, 122, and 140 are the only story id's
that are missing. It would be interesting to know what 120 and 122
were.

I will set up a nightly backup job tonight so that we have database
backups made every night so if we lose stuff in the future we can get
it back.

I will start monitoring for more "missing" ids and see what is
disappearing when and maybe we can track it down.
